KANNAPOLIS, N.C. — Savannah scored three runs in the last two innings, then held off the host Intimidators’ rally for a 3-2 Sand Gnats victory Tuesday night in Class A South Atlantic League action.
The Sand Gnats (42-20) moved closer to the Southern Division’s first-half title but the win wasn’t secured until closer Robert Coles (11 saves, 1.95 ERA) got Trey Michalczewski on a called strike three with two runners on base and another runner already home in the bottom of the ninth.
With the game tied at 1 through eight innings, Savannah’s Jeff McNeil led off with a walk and L.J. Mazzilli singled. The runners advanced on Dominic Smith’s sacrifice bunt.
McNeil scored and Mazzilli took third when Jorge Rivero reached base on shortstop Tyler Shryock’s throwing error.
Mazzilli scored when Amed Rosario reached on a fielder’s choice fielded by pitcher Jose Brito (0-1, 4.82). Rivero safely got to second.
Kannapolis (29-34) scored the game’s first run with two outs in the fifth. Kale Kiser tripled to center and came home on Christian Stringer’s single which deflected off pitcher Ricky Knapp.
The Gnats did little against Intimidators starter Robinson Leyer (four hits, no walks, nine strikeouts), before he exited after seven scoreless innings. Leyer’s replacement, Brito, gave up a triple to the first batter he faced, Rosario.
One out later, Colton Plaia singled home Rosario for a 1-1 tie.
